István Pelle (July 26, 1907 – March 6, 1986) was a Hungarian gymnast and Olympic champion.

He competed at the 1932 Summer Olympics in Los Angeles where he received gold medals in floor exercises and pommel horse, and silver medals in parallel bars and individual all-around.

After World War II, he left Hungary, toured as an artist, and eventually settled in Argentina.
